Based in Peterborough, the Caterpillar Technology team offers some of the most dynamic and forward-thinking engineering opportunities within the global Caterpillar organisation. Our work focuses on integrating cutting-edge electronic control systems across a wide range of Caterpillar products, driving innovation and delivering exceptional value to our customers. By leveraging the latest advancements in Electronics and Electrical technology, we enable superior product performance and differentiation in the marketplace. Our engine systems precisely manage air and fuel delivery, power response, and aftertreatment processes to optimise performance and minimise emissions. Our battery management systems incorporate advanced algorithms for State of Charge (SoC), State of Health (SoH), and State of Function (SoF), ensuring functional safety and efficient energy management. These systems seamlessly integrate with powertrain controllers, chargers, and machine controls. We also develop fully integrated machine systems that govern every aspect of construction equipment operation, from engine and transmission control to electric powertrains and hydraulics. These systems provide intuitive human-machine interfaces, monitor real-time diagnostics and prognostics, and enable automation, enhanced productivity, and improved serviceability.
